The Houston Comets were a professional women’s basketball team established in 1997. They were one of the original eight teams of the WNBA. The Houston Tunnel System is a network of climate-controlled, pedestrian walkways, 20 feet below Houston’s downtown streets. It links 95 city blocks and connects office towers to hotels, banks, restaurants, stores, and the Houston Theater District. The tunnels are approximately 6 miles long. AstroWorld opened in 1968. The theme park was originally owned by Roy Hofheinz. In 1978, his family sold it to Six Flags.
